1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 11 12 13 14 15 16 17 18 19 83rd OREGON LEGISLATIVE ASSEMBLY--2025 Regular Session HOUSE AMENDMENTS TO HOUSE BILL 2566 By COMMITTEE ON CLIMATE, ENERGY, AND ENVIRONMENT March 26 On page 4 of the printed bill, line 33, after the period insert “Systems, technologies, equipment or measures associated with a distribution system may be eligible to be considered as part of a stand-alone energy resilience project. Rules adopted under this paragraph may not allow, as part of a stand-alone energy resilience project, the construction, installation or repair of an energy gener- ation system that is not a renewable energy system.”. On page 5 , delete lines 21 through 24 and insert: “(B) 50 percent or more for grants to be awarded for the following: “(i) Planning or developing community renewable energy projects that primarily serve one or more qualifying communities; or “(ii) Developing stand-alone energy resilience projects that primarily serve one or more quali- fyingcommunities. “(b) For each opportunity announcement for developing a stand-alone energy resilience project that the department issues, the department shall allocate, out of the moneys made available in the calendar interval for all grants under the Community Renewable and Resilient Energy Grant Pro- gram, 20 percent for grants for developing stand-alone energy resilience projects. The department may reallocate moneys that were initially allocated but not awarded under an opportunity an- nouncement for developing a stand-alone energy resilience project that the department issues.”.
